Easy Beef Enchilada Pasta (Printable)

A quick one-pot dish combining beef, enchilada sauce, pasta, and cheddar for a flavorful meal.

# What You'll Need:

→ Protein & Dairy

01 - 1 lb lean ground beef
02 - 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
03 - 1/2 cup sour cream

→ Pasta

04 - 8 oz penne or rotini pasta

→ Vegetables

05 - 1 medium onion, diced
06 - 3 cloves garlic, minced

→ Sauce

07 - 1 cup enchilada sauce

# Method:

01 - Cook ground beef in a large skillet over medium heat until no longer pink, about 5 to 7 minutes. Drain excess fat.
02 - Add diced onion and minced garlic to the skillet and cook until onion becomes translucent, about 3 to 4 minutes.
03 - Pour in enchilada sauce and simmer for 5 minutes to meld flavors.
04 - Boil pasta in salted water following package directions until al dente; then drain thoroughly.
05 - Add drained pasta to the skillet with beef and sauce; stir well to evenly incorporate and warm through.
06 - Plate and garnish with shredded cheddar cheese and a dollop of sour cream.

02 -
  • Drain excess fat after cooking the beef to avoid a greasy sauce.
  • Simmer the enchilada sauce briefly with the beef to meld flavors fully.
  • Cook pasta al dente to keep a pleasant texture when combined with sauce.
  • Use a wooden spoon to gently mix pasta with the beef mixture to avoid breaking pasta.
